Egypt stun world champions Italy

Egypt stun world champions Italy

JOHANNESBURG, June 18 (Reuters) – Egypt scored their greatest ever victory with a thoroughly deserved 1-0 win on Thursday over world champions Italy who had never previously lost to an African team.

South Africa 2-0 New Zealand: Host's hopes alive

South Africa 2-0 New Zealand: Host’s hopes alive

Striker Bernard Parker made amends for the blunder which cost South Africa victory in the opening match of the Confederations Cup by scoring twice on Wednesday in a 2-0 win over New Zealand.
